PM Modi terms Mamata's opposition to SIR ploy to protect infiltrators: 'Law will punish those who entered India illegally'

Addressing a public rally, PM Modi said, "TMC is attacking the state's education system through corruption and crime."

Prime Minister Narendra Modi addressed a rally in Bengal's Durgapur.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Friday slammed the Mamata Banerjee-led Trinamool Congress (TMC) for encouraging infiltration in West Bengal and said that "this is a big threat to the state and country".

Addressing a public rally at West Bengal's Durgapur, PM Modi said, "For its own benefit, the TMC government has put the identity of West Bengal at stake. Infiltration is being encouraged in the state. Fake documents are being made for the infiltrators. An entire ecosystem has been developed. This is a big threat to West Bengal and the country... In the politics of appeasement, TMC is crossing all limits...Action will be taken against those who are not citizens of the nation..."

Mamata Banerjee had earlier accused the Election Commission of India (ECI) of "acting like a stooge of the BJP" and wondered if the implementation of the Special Intensive Revision (SIR) of electoral roll was a "backdoor attempt to implement the National Register of Citizens".

Assembly polls in Bengal are due next year and the poll body has decided to conduct a Special Intensive Revision of voter lists in the state. Such a revision is currently being done in Bihar. Banerjee has alleged that this is part of a conspiracy to delete the names of valid voters, especially the migrants and the underprivileged.

A few days back, the Bengal CM also took out a march in rain-soaked Kolkata to protest the alleged harassment of Bengali speakers in BJP-ruled states. Accusing the BJP-led central and state governments of targeting Bengali migrants, she said Bengal fought for India's freedom, and BJP should be ashamed.

Countering this claim, PM Modi in Durgapur said, "Wherever there is BJP government, Bengalis are respected." In addition to this, he alleged that the Mamata Banerjee-led government cannot protect the lives of the people of West Bengal.

"You all have seen how, when a young doctor was subjected to atrocities here, the TMC government got involved in protecting the culprits. The country hadn’t even recovered from that incident when, in another college, a horrific crime was committed against another young woman. In that case too, the accused were found to have links with the TMC..." said PM Modi.

He was referring to the 2024 RG Kar Medical rape and murder case and the recent Kolkata law college gang-rape case.
